SUMMER COOLING CHECKLIST
Stay comfortable, efficient, and energy-smart during hot weather.
BEFORE SUMMER STARTS
-
Replace or clean air filters
-
Inspect outdoor condenser for leaves or dirt
-
Check thermostat calibration and settings
-
Ensure all vents are open and clean
-
Run the system early to confirm proper cooling
DURING SUMMER
-
Keep doors and windows sealed
-
Monitor airflow and cooling consistency
-
Use ceiling fans to support airflow
-
Avoid blocking outdoor units with plants or furniture
EFFICIENCY TIPS
-
Set thermostat to an energy-efficient temperature
-
Clean return air vents regularly
-
Book servicing if cooling feels weak or uneven
WINTER HEATING CHECKLIST
Prepare your home for colder months and avoid unexpected breakdowns.
BEFORE WINTER STARTS
-
Replace or clean air filters
-
Check thermostat settings and batteries
-
Inspect vents and registers for blockage
-
Ensure outdoor units are clear of debris
-
Test your heating system early (don’t wait for the first cold night)
DURING WINTER
-
Keep vents open and unobstructed
-
Monitor unusual noises or smells
-
Maintain consistent temperature settings
-
Check for uneven heating between rooms
SAFETY & EFFICIENCY
-
Test smoke and carbon monoxide detectors
-
Keep flammable items away from heaters
-
Schedule a professional system check if performance drops
